Hardened teeth on the smaller sprocket of a roller chain drive are recommended if the drive ratio is four to one or greater or if the smaller sprocket has 24 teeth or less and is running at a speed of over 600 rpm.
features
Tolerances meet or exceed ANSI standards
Manufactured of high carbon steel
Precise machining and processes ensure consistent finish and high quality
Chain rows are parallel and precisely spaced to increase longevity of sprocket and chain
Bores are concentric to pitch line, minimizing run out
Interchangeable with other manufacturers’ Taper bushings
